What's the fewest points allowed by the 76ers in the 2005 Playoffs?
The Philadelphia 76ers allowed 88 points on May 3, 2005, in their loss to the Detroit Pistons 88-78. That was the team's best defensive performance in the 5 games they played in the 2005 NBA Playoffs.
